Special glasses for dogs: German success spreads to UK

Confident after its success at home, a German company is now preparing to take over the British market with its special sunglasses for dogs.

La Dog-Goes became immensely popular at the beginning of the year when it distributed products that were initially made to protect the sight of rescue dogs that had to cope with snowstorms or the dangerous glare of the sun. But when a television channel broadcast a program about this eye protection to canine clubs in Gastein, the company was swamped with requests from the general public who wanted the glasses for their own dogs. This led to the idea. And now Dog-Goes products have become a cult accessory for 'dog fashion victims'.

The Dog-Goes glasses have an elastic band and lenses (including mirror lenses) that come in different shapes so they can be adapted to fit any size of dog muzzle. Currently, prices range from 40 to 60 pounds sterling. Silvia Wilsch Herold, manager of the company, stated: 'We have also had hundreds of requests for a model with gold-colored frames which we produced especially for Yorkshire Terriers'.
